Annie Knight Recalls Feeling Like Relationship With Fiance Henry Brayshaw Was ‘Falling Apart’
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

OnlyFans creator Annie Knight is reflecting on the relationship ups and downs she’s faced with fiancé Henry Brayshaw.

“Episode 6 of TODSM was filmed during the most challenging week of my life,” Knight wrote via Instagram on Sunday, June 28, referring to new reality series Turned On: Dirty, Sexy Money. “My relationship was falling apart, my dream life was falling apart … I was falling apart. For months I tried to carry the burden of supporting my fiancé through his gambling addiction alone. Every week we went through the same cycle. He slips up, he gets upset, I put my feelings of anger and hurt aside to support him, he apologizes, I forgive… and then the next weekend it happens all over again.”

She continued, “It’s a constant cycle and one I’m sure many reading this can relate to. My mistake was thinking I was strong enough to bear the weight of this alone. No one person can ‘save’ another from a mental health condition that is this powerful. If you’re reading this and you can relate, talk to someone, seek help. This will not just ‘go away.’ The only way for them to fully recover is to seek treatment.”

Knight shared that her direct messages are “open to anyone who needs advice on this matter,” adding that she’s “happy to help anyone so they don’t feel as alone as [she] did at the end.”

“A huge thank you to our amazing talent coordinator, Denise, on the show. I couldn’t have gotten through this without her,” she wrote. “Also a massive thanks to our exec production team; Emma, Leigh and Jo for encouraging me to be brave enough to tell my story. Hopefully it helps others out there to feel less alone ❤️.”

After years of friendship, Knight and Brayshaw’s platonic relationship turned romantic in early 2025 — before announcing their engagement in March of that year.

“I’ve known him forever, and we just were so perfect for each other in an unconventional way. A lot of people are like, ‘I don’t understand how this works.’ But we do and that’s what’s important and that’s why it is so perfect, because we understand it,” she exclusively told Us Weekly in May 2025. “I just immediately knew it was a yes. I’m really excited to marry him.”

The pair are looking toward an October 2026 wedding on the Gold Coast in the Australian state of Queensland, with dog Billy serving as ring bearer. One year prior, Knight told Us she had a “wedding spreadsheet” as she planned their nuptials.

“There’s a few little last-minute details that I need to do, like the cake and the bridesmaids’ dresses and whatnot, but it’s going to be a medium-sized wedding [with] 80 people,” she explained to Us in 2025. “We’re not sparing any expense. But surprisingly, it hasn’t been as bad as I thought in terms of price.”

If you or someone you know is struggling with a gambling addiction, call or text The National Problem Gambling Helpline Network at 1-800-GAMBLER.
